#95575e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95575e is composed of 58.4% red, 34.1%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.6%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.3% and a lightness of 46.3%. #95575e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aebc with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#95575e color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#95575e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95575e has RGB values of R:149, G:87,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.37,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9787230.

Shades and Tints of #95575e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95575e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7273 is the less saturated color, while #e7051f is the most saturated one.
